Multilingual LLMs vulnerable to attacks bypassing English safety guardrails

Current AI safety alignment methods, which primarily focus on English, create significant vulnerabilities in multilingual large language models. These models can be exploited through attacks in less common languages or subtle formatting, bypassing expensive English-centric guardrails. The paper argues that true safety requires moving beyond superficial prompt filters to geometric interventions that address the underlying semantic representations within the model's latent space.
